Anyone been wondering just where WWE diva Kharma is?
After taking several months off due to her real-life pregnancy, the former TNA Knockout shockingly re-emerged at the Royal Rumble in late January. She didn't last long, but she managed to make quite the impression, eliminating Smackdown star Hunico (she also scared off annoying WWE announcer Michael Cole, who ran for his life at the sight of her).
In this week's Wrestling Observer Newsletter, Dave Meltzer gave a big update on the star's whereabouts, and also hinted at future plans when she does eventually make her return to the company.
The reason the Kharma appearance at the Rumble hasn't been followed up on is she hasn't fully recovered from giving birth and isn't yet ready to work a full-time schedule, although that should be soon and they are seemingly building a program with Phoenix. They figured keeping it short and simple at the Rumble would create a good story part for the match since people weren't expecting it.
